Are they all in on this season? Can we point to any team that has gone all in on this season?

If the Cowboys were all in on this season, they would have been more active in FA like signing Thomas. Not that that works because we've seen that fail with numerous teams.

I think what they're trying to do is get into sustained contender status like GB, NO, PHL, SEA and LAR have done. Then with a little luck, any of those teams can go to the Big Dance. But going all in or selling out for one season hasn't proven to be effective and the Cowboys have not done that this offseason.
